Skultorp is a locality situated in Skövde Municipality, Västra Götaland County, Sweden with 3,642 inhabitants in 2010. On February 20, 1965, a major train accident in Skultorp claimed 10 lives. Skultorp is situated 5 km west of Lilla Bäckstorp.

Skövde is a locality and urban centre in Skövde Municipality and Västra Götaland County, in the Västergötland in central southern Sweden. Skövde is situated around 150 km northeast of Gothenburg, between Sweden's two largest lakes, Vänern and Vättern.
